Monitored fire protection system
First Claim
1. An electrical protection system comprising:
- a plurality of suppressor units activatable to suppress an abnormal condition;
a plurality of electrical current responsive activators, one associated with each of said suppressor units and adapted to induce activation thereof;
an activator current supply means;
activator control circuit means comprising series circuit means connecting said activators in series, a sensor means for said abnormal condition, and initiator means responsive to said sensor means for initiating activating current flow from said activator supply means to said series connected activators so as to induce activation of said suppressor units;
a supervisory current supply means providing through said series connected activators a constant level of supervisory current flow insufficient to induce activation of said suppressor units;
fault voltage responsive means for detecting a given abnormally high voltage level across said series connected activators; and
switching circuit means for connecting said activators in parallel in response to detection of said abnormally high voltage across said series connected activators.

Abstract
An electrical fire protection system including a plurality of extinguishant filled suppressor units activatable by explosive squibs connected in series. In response to the detection of an abnormal condition associated with fires, a control circuit initiates an activating current flow that detonates the explosive squibs and induces release of the extinguishant from the suppressor units. A supervisory current supply establishes through the series connected squibs, a constant level of supervisory current flow that is insufficient to induce detonation of the squibs but establishes a detectable voltage drop thereacross. In response to the detection of an abnormally high voltage level across the series connected squibs, a switching circuit switches the squibs from a series to a parallel circuit relationship.
